Weather in Surabaya in March
Indonesia · 20-year averages, March
Shoulder season. March is shoulder season in Surabaya — cheaper, quieter, and a genuine gamble. You should expect rain on 28 days of the month, which is more days wet than dry.
March ranks 8 of 12 in Surabaya: past the worst of the year but short of August, which is the month to book if the dates are open.
Rain on 28 of the month's 31 days, 10 of them heavy. At that frequency a wet-weather backup is not a contingency, it is the itinerary — book the indoor things first and treat the clear days as the bonus. Natural fibres and a second shirt for the day. At 84% nothing dries, including you.
What the averages hide
Averages flatten a month, and this one hides a few things: 7 days top 30 °C — hot spells arrive, but they break; the day barely swings — 3.3 °C between the overnight low and the afternoon high. Across the twenty years measured, the hottest March day reached 31.6 °C and the coldest night fell to 24.1 °C, and the wettest single day dropped 55 mm — roughly 20% of the month's rain in one day.
March is statistically steady but not small: the year-to-year variation is modest in relative terms, yet the wettest March on record still delivered 420 mm against 151 mm in the driest. In a month this wet, even a tame spread is a lot of rain in absolute terms — the 272 mm average is a reasonable planning figure, not a promise.
Wind is light at 8.5 km/h, so the temperature on the page is close to the temperature on your skin, and humidity runs at 84%, high enough to notice on the warm days without dominating them.
How March sits in the year
Temperatures hold steady either side: 28.8 °C in February, 29.2 here, 29.8 in April. Nothing about the timing within the month matters much.
Daylight in March
Surabaya sits close enough to the equator that daylight barely moves all year — 12.2 hours in March, against a range of just 0.8 hours across the whole calendar. Sunrise and sunset land at roughly the same time whenever you come.
Sea temperature
The sea sits at about 29.1 °C in March — warm enough that the water offers no relief from the heat. This is the warmest the water gets all year.

Every month in Surabaya
| Month | High °C | Low °C | Rain days | Rain mm | Humidity % | Daylight h | Sea °C | Score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 29 | 25.7 | 29 | 337 | 85 | 12.5 | 28.9 | 52 |
| February | 28.8 | 25.6 | 27 | 316 | 86 | 12.3 | 28.7 | 52 |
| March | 29.2 | 25.8 | 28 | 272 | 84 | 12.2 | 29.1 | 51 |
| April | 29.8 | 26.3 | 24 | 193 | 82 | 12 | 29.8 | 51 |
| May | 30.2 | 26.1 | 18 | 123 | 80 | 11.8 | 29.8 | 53 |
| June | 30.5 | 25.3 | 11 | 74 | 77 | 11.7 | 29.3 | 64 |
| July | 31.2 | 24.7 | 6 | 35 | 72 | 11.7 | 28.5 | 70 |
| August | 32.4 | 24.7 | 2 | 11 | 65 | 11.9 | 28.1 | 73 |
| September | 33.8 | 25.7 | 4 | 18 | 61 | 12.1 | 28.3 | 62 |
| October | 33.7 | 26.8 | 10 | 63 | 64 | 12.3 | 29 | 51 |
| November | 31.9 | 26.9 | 21 | 139 | 73 | 12.4 | 29.8 | 43 |
| December | 29.7 | 26.1 | 29 | 300 | 82 | 12.5 | 29.6 | 51 |
